1
0
Fork 0

Tweak screen locking

This commit is contained in:
Malte Brandy 2021-10-08 12:32:57 +02:00
parent 026f1c0b84
commit e86b32fbfb
No known key found for this signature in database
GPG key ID: 226A2D41EF5378C9
4 changed files with 26 additions and 0 deletions

View file

@ -95,10 +95,12 @@ in
{
apollo = daily-driver "apollo" [
./roles/battery.nix
./roles/untrusted-env.nix
];
zeus = daily-driver "zeus" [
./roles/hourly-maintenance.nix
./roles/state.nix
./roles/trusted-env.nix
];
hera = {
default = makeConfig "hera" (on-my-machines ++ [

View file

@ -180,6 +180,14 @@ in
region = "en_DK.UTF-8";
};
"org/gnome/desktop/screensaver" = {
lock-delay = "0"; # lock screen immediately on screen blank
};
"org/gnome/desktop/session" = {
idle-delay = "300"; # blank screen after 5 minutes
};
"org/gnome/shell/extensions/system-monitor" = {
center-display = true;
compact-display = true;

View file

@ -0,0 +1,8 @@
{ ... }:
{
dconf.settings = {
"org/gnome/desktop/screensaver" = {
lock = false;
};
};
}

View file

@ -0,0 +1,8 @@
{ ... }:
{
dconf.settings = {
"org/gnome/desktop/screensaver" = {
lock = true;
};
};
}